Floodplain

//ˈflʌdˌpleɪn// noun

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    A low-lying plain adjacent to a river subject to flooding during periods of high rainfall or at high tide.

    "Near-synonyms: bottomland, bottomlands"

  2. 2
    a low plain adjacent to a river that is formed chiefly of river sediment and is subject to flooding wordnet

Etymology

From flood + plain.
